Degree Requirements


Completion of requirements for a bachelor’s degree

A minimum of 120 academic (non-PE) semester hours of credit.

At least 42 academic credits must be upper division (300- to 400-level).

A cumulative scholastic average of 2.0.

General education courses must be completed with an average GPA of at least 2.0.

All general education, major, minor, area of concentration, or teacher licensure requirements must be satisfied.

All students must demonstrate writing proficiency by the end of the sophomore year.

No D grade may apply to a major or minor field.

For elementary education licensure, students must complete the Content Area Emphasis and Bachelor of Arts in Interdisciplinary Studies Degree Requirements
